Output 56864c9744024037fda3c751cd04e7d3b2eb46eaf211aded3f340a91e126b1c4:0

value
306950251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01ef0ab9b185fe51aafc783a9bd87072c0c6bf8b OP_EQUAL
address
31sExf6ijQv56XT26ZYzTShoVQbLkXgyov
transaction
56864c9744024037fda3c751cd04e7d3b2eb46eaf211aded3f340a91e126b1c4
spent
true